    I watched it and gotta say talk about streamlining things, and making you realize some things in Prometheus weren't truly needed.
    I'm a fan of Prometheus, not so much with Covenant, though I really dug this cut.
    What I loved is how Willins used the extended opening act of Covenant and cut it to three pieces as markers to reveal what David truly is and his thoughts about humanity. I was floored.
    Also appreciated that he brought more stuff with Shaw from the cut scenes since it made her more human and truly became a gut punch when we see her demise.
    The ending were he sends that message back to Weyland was chilling, I just think why did Ridley of Fox cut that out.
    For me, this will be the cut that show to my friends when they want to watch the Prequels.
